Given the current lack of effective COVID-19 treatment, it is necessary to explore alternative methods to contain the spread of the infection, focusing in particular on its mode of transmission. The modes of person-to-person transmission of SARS-CoV-2 are direct transmission, such as sneezing, coughing, transmission through inhalation of small droplets, and transmission through contact, such as contact with nasal, oral and eye mucous membranes. SARS-CoV-2 can also be transmitted directly or indirectly through saliva. The use of antiviral mouthrinses may be used as adjunctive therapy.
